执行音频水印嵌入以及水印检测和提取的方法和装置制造方法及图纸

技术编号:11076288 阅读:111 留言:0更新日期:2015-02-25 14:41
本文描述了执行音频水印嵌入以及水印检测和提取的方法和装置。根据示例方法,当不同的标识以前已经被编码时将一标识编码在媒体内容中。根据另一示例方法,从媒体内容解码出来的消息被验证以提供经改进的解码精度。在另一示例方法中,将经解码的符号存储在存储器中并定位同步符号以检测被编码在媒体内容中的消息。

【技术实现步骤摘要】
执行音频水印嵌入以及水印检测和提取的方法和装置 本申请是申请日为2009年10月22日、申请号为200980152527. 3、国际申请号为 PCT/US2009/061749、专利技术名称为执行音频水印嵌入以及水印检测和提取的方法和装置 的原案申请的分案申请。 相关申请 本申请要求2009年5月1日提交的题目为METHODSANDAPPARATUSTOPERFORM AUDIOWATERMARKINGANDWATERMARKDETECTIONANDEXTRACTION 的美国临时申请序 号No. 61/174, 708 和 2008 年 10 月 24 日提交的题目为STACKINGMETHODFORADVANCED WATERMARKDETECTION的美国临时申请序号No. 61/108, 380的优选权,通过引用将这两个 临时申请的公开的全部内容并入本文。
本专利技术总体上涉及媒体监测,更具体地说,涉及执行音频水印嵌入以及水印检测 和提取的方法和装置。
技术介绍
识别媒体信息,更具体地说,识别音频流(例如,音频信息)对于评估电视、无线电 广播或任何其它媒体的受众接触率(audienceexposure)是有用的。例如,在电视观众统 计(metering)应用中,可以将代码插入到媒体的音频或视频中,其中,随后在呈现(例如, 在所监测的住宅处播放)该媒体时在监测点检测该代码。嵌入到原始信号中的代码/水印 的信息的有效载荷可以包括唯一的源标识、广播时间信息、业务(transactional)信息或 附加的内容元数据。 监测点通常包括诸如监测受众成员的媒体消费或媒体的受众成员接触率的住宅 的地点。例如,在监测点,来自音频和/或视频的代码被捕获并可以与和所选择的频道、无 线电台、媒体源等相关联的媒体的音频流或视频流相关联。所收集的代码接着可以被发送 到中央数据收集设施以进行分析。但是,与媒体接触率或消费相关的数据的收集不必限于 在家中的接触率或消费。
技术实现思路
本专利技术的一方面提供了 一种将媒体内容变换为消息的方法,该方法包括以下步 骤:确定被编码在经编码的音频样本中的第一符号;将所述第一符号存储在有形的存储器 中;确定被编码在所述经编码的音频样本中的第二符号;将所述第二符号存储在所述有形 的存储器中;确定所述第一符号匹配所述第二符号;以及响应于所述确定:确定所述第一 符号和所述第二符号经验证;以及输出所述第一符号。 本专利技术的另一方面提供了一种将媒体内容变换为消息的装置,该装置包括:最大 得分选择器,其用于确定被编码在经编码的音频样本中的第一符号,将所述第一符号存储 在有形的存储器中,确定被编码在所述经编码的音频样本中的第二符号,将所述第二符号 存储在所述有形的存储器中;验证器,其用于确定所述第一符号匹配所述第二符号,并响应 于所述确定来确定所述第一符号和所述第二符号经验证,并输出所述第一符号。 本专利技术的另一方面提供了一种将媒体内容变换为消息的方法,该方法包括以下步 骤:在经编码的音频样本中顺序地检测第一符号、第二符号、第三符号和第四符号;将所述 第一符号、所述第二符号、所述第三符号和所述第四符号存储在有形的存储器中;确定所述 第一符号是同步符号;响应于所述确定,确定所述第一符号和所述第三符号与第一消息相 关联且所述第二符号和所述第四符号与第二消息相关联;以及输出所述第一消息。 本专利技术的另一方面提供了一种将媒体内容变换为消息的装置,该装置包括:最大 得分选择器,其用于在经编码的音频样本中顺序地检测第一符号、第二符号、第三符号和第 四符号,以及将所述第一符号、所述第二符号、所述第三符号和所述第四符号存储在有形的 存储器中;消息识别器,其用于确定所述第一符号是同步符号,响应于所述确定来确定所述 第一符号和所述第三符号与第一消息相关联且所述第二符号和所述第四符号与第二消息 相关联,以及输出所述第一消息。 【附图说明】 图1是采用添加到复合电视信号的音频部分的节目识别码的广播受众测量系统 的示意图。 图2是图1的示例编码器的框图。 图3是例示可以由图2的示例解码器执行的示例编码处理的流程图。 图4是例示可以被执行以产生与图2的代码频率选择器相结合使用的频率索引表 的示例处理的流程图。 图5是例示关键(critical)频带索引以及它们如何与短和长的块样本索引相对 应的图表。 图6例示选择将表示具体信息符号的频率分量的一个示例。 图7至图9是例示可以由图4的处理产生的并与图2的代码频率选择器相结合使 用的不同的示例代码频率配置的图表。 图10例不首频编码索引之间的频率关系。 图11是图1的示例解码器的框图。 图12是例示可以由图11的示例编码器执行的示例解码处理的流程图。 图13是可以被执行以在图11的解码器中叠加(stack)音频的示例处理的流程 图。 图14是可以被执行以在图11的解码器中确定编码在音频信号中的符号的示例处 理的流程图。 图15是可以被执行以处理缓冲器从而识别图11的解码器中的消息的示例处理的 流程图。 图16例示可以存储消息符号的示例循环缓冲器组。 图17例示可以存储消息符号的示例预先存在代码标记循环缓冲器组。 图18是可以被执行以在图11的解码器中验证所识别的消息的示例处理的流程 图。 图19例示可以在图11的解码器中存储所识别的消息的示例过滤器堆栈(stack)。 图20是示例处理器平台的示意图,该示例处理器平台可以用于和/或编码为执行 本文所述的任何或全部处理或者实现本文所述的任何或全部示例系统、示例装置和/或示 例方法。 【具体实施方式】 下面的描述参照音频编码和解码,该音频编码和解码通常还分别被称为音频水印 嵌入(audiowatermarking)和水印检测。应当注意,在该背景中,音频可以是具有落入正 常人能听到的频谱内的频率的任意类型的信号。例如,音频可以是语音、音乐、音频和/或 视频节目或作品(例如,电视节目、电影、互联网视频、无线电节目、商业短片等)的音频部 分、媒体节目、噪声或任何其它声音。 一般地说,如下文详细描述的,对音频进行的编码将一个或更多个代码或信息 (例如,水印)插入到音频中且理想地使该代码对于音频的听者不可听到。但是,在特定情 形中,该代码会被特定听者听见。嵌入在音频中的代码可以是任意适当的长度,并且可以选 择任意适当的技术将代码分配到信息中。 如下文描述的,要插入到音频中的代码或信息可以被转换为由代码频率信号表示 的符号,这些代码频率信号要被嵌入到音频中以表示信息。这些代码频率信号包括一个或 更多个代码频率,其中,分配不同的代码频率或代码频率的组以表示不同的信息符号。还描 述了用于产生一个或更多个将符号映射到代表性代码频率的表以使得这些符号在解码器 处彼此可区分的技术。可以使用任何适当的编码或纠错技术来将代码转换为符号。 通过控制将这些代码频率信号输入到原始(native)音频中时的振幅,人的听觉 可以察觉不到这些代码频率信号的存在。因此,在一个示例中,使用基于不同频率处的原始 音频的内能(energyc本文档来自技高网
...
执行音频水印嵌入以及水印检测和提取的方法和装置

【技术保护点】
一种将媒体内容变换为消息的方法,该方法包括以下步骤:确定被编码在经编码的音频样本中的第一符号;将所述第一符号存储在有形的存储器中;确定被编码在所述经编码的音频样本中的第二符号;将所述第二符号存储在所述有形的存储器中;确定所述第一符号匹配所述第二符号;以及响应于所述确定:确定所述第一符号和所述第二符号经验证;以及输出所述第一符号。

【技术特征摘要】
2008.10.24 US 61/108,380;2009.05.01 US 61/174,708;1. 一种将媒体内容变换为消息的方法,该方法包括以下步骤: 确定被编码在经编码的音频样本中的第一符号; 将所述第一符号存储在有形的存储器中; 确定被编码在所述经编码的音频样本中的第二符号; 将所述第二符号存储在所述有形的存储器中; 确定所述第一符号匹配所述第二符号;以及 响应于所述确定: 确定所述第一符号和所述第二符号经验证;以及 输出所述第一符号。2. 根据权利要求1所述的方法,其中,将所述第一符号和所述第二符号以堆栈的形式 存储在所述有形的存储器中。3.根据权利要求2所述的方法,该方法还包括以下步骤:响应于所述确定从所述堆栈 弹出所述第一符号。4.根据权利要求1所述的方法,其中,将所述第一符号编码在以第一样本开始的第一 组至少一个样本中,并且将所述第二符号编码在以与所述第一样本不同的第二样本开始的 第二组至少一个样本中。5.根据权利要求4所述的方法,该方法还包括以下步骤:计算所述第一样本与所述第 二样本之间的样本的数量。6.根据权利要求5所述的方法,其中,响应于所述确定并且在所述样本的数量是符号 编码重复速率的倍数时,执行输出所述第一符号的步骤。7.根据权利要求1所述的方法,该方法还包括以下步骤:响应于所述确定来将所述第 二符号识别为经验证。8. -种将媒体内容变换为消息的装置,该装置包括: 最大得分选择器,其用于确定被编码在经编码的音频样本中的第一符号,将所述第一 符号存储在有形的存储器中,确定被编码在所述经编码的音频样本中的第二符号,将所述 第二符号存储在所述有形的存储器中; 验证器,其用于确定所述第一符号匹配所述第二符号,并响应于所述确定来确定所述 第一符号和所述第二符号经验证,并输出所述第一符号。9.根据权利要求8所述的装置,其中,将所述第一符号和所述第二符号以堆栈的形式 存储在所述有形的存储器中。10.根据权利要求9所述的装置,其中,所述验证器还响应于所述确定来从所述堆栈弹 出所述第一符号。11. 根据权利要求8所述的装置,其中,将所述第一符号编码在以第一样本开始的第一 组至少一个样本中,并且将所述第二符号编码在以与所述第一样本不同的第二样本开始的 第二组至少一个样本中。12. 根据权利要求11所述的装置,其中,所述验证器还计算所述第一样本与所述第二 样本之间的样本的数量。13.根据权利要求12所述的装置,其中,所述验证器响应于所述确定并在所述样本的 数量是符号编码重复速率的倍数时,输出所述第一符号。14. 根据权利要求8所述的装置,其中,所述验证器还响应于所述确定将所述第二符号 识别为经验证。15. 根据权利要求8所述的装置,其中,所述最大得分选择器通过以下步骤来确定所述 第一经编码符号:接收针对两个或更多个可能的符号的指示进行编码的可能性的得分;以 及选择具有最大得分的符号。16. -种将媒体内容变换为消息的方法,该方法包括以下步骤: 在经编码的音频样本中顺序地检测第一符号、第二符号、第三符号和第四符号; 将所述第一符号、所述第二符号、所述第三符号和所述第四符号存储在有形的存储器 中; 确定所述第一符号是同步符号; 响应于所述确定,确定所述第一符号和所述第三符号与第一消息相关联且所述第二符 号和所述第四符号与第二消息相关联;以及 输出所述第一消息。17. 根据权利要求16所述的方法,该方法还包括以下步骤:将所述第一消息存储在所 述有形的存储器中。18. 根据权利要求16所述的方法,其中,将所述第一符号、所述第二符号、所述第三符 号和所述第四符号存储在所述有形的存储器中的至少一个循环缓冲器中。19. 根据权利要求16所述的方法,其中,将所述第一符号、所述第二符号、所述第三符 号和所述第四符号存储在所述有形的存储器中的步骤包括以下步骤:将所述第一符号存储 在第一循环缓冲器中的第一位置中,将所述第二符号存储在第二循环缓冲器中的第一位置 中,将所述第三符号存储在所述第一循环缓冲器中的第二位置中,以及将所述第四符...

【专利技术属性】
技术研发人员:韦努戈帕尔·斯里尼瓦桑亚历山大·帕夫洛维奇·托普奇
申请(专利权)人:尼尔森美国有限公司
类型:发明
国别省市:美国;US

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1